High-rate exchange near Han Market: “Soan Ha” gold shop Summary Vietnam’s currency is the “dong” Photo: the highest denomination 500,000 VND note First, some basics about the currency. You might be confused by the many zeros when using the Vietnamese dong. Here’s an easy way to grasp it: Denominations of the Vietnamese dong The highest denomination is 500,000 VND (about 3,000 JPY). As a quick way to convert to Japanese yen, remove the last “000” and multiply by 6. Example: 100,000 VND ≈ 600 JPY 200,000 VND ≈ 1,200 JPY 500,000 VND ≈ 3,000 JPY About the “K” abbreviation In Vietnam, the letter “K” is commonly used to mean “thousand.” For example: 100K = 100,000 VND You’ll often see this on restaurant menus, at cafes, and on outdoor price boards. How to exchange in Da Nang and key tips How to exchange Japanese yen to Vietnamese dong and key points/ We explain how to exchange Japanese yen into Vietnamese dong and tips to get a better deal. Check the market rate Before you exchange, it’s important to check the current rate. You can find the market rate by searching “JPY VND” on Google or on transfer services such as Wise. Exchange fees At jewelry shops in Da Nang, the fee is often around 1% from the market rate. Example: Market rate: 1 JPY = 162 VND With a 1% fee: 162 VND × (1 - 1%) = approx. 160.38 VND per 1 JPY That means exchanging 10,000 JPY gives you about 1,603,800 VND. Better to exchange larger amounts You often get a better rate when exchanging larger amounts. However, some shops display the yen rate based on VND as the base currency. 1. Exchange only the minimum at Da Nang Airport 1.1 Foreign currency exchange in the International Arrivals Hall Location: Terminal 1F, near the baggage claim area Hours: Open 24 hours Supported currencies: All major currencies such as USD, EUR, JPY, SGD Additional services: Luggage storage: 50,000 VND per item At the Vietcombank counter, drinks are also sold for 10,000 VND (about 60 JPY) per bottle (available at the counter or via vending machine). Staff are proficient in foreign languages and can serve international customers. Recommended points: Rates at the airport are higher than in the city, but it’s convenient for taxi fares and initial payments Exchange only the necessary minimum and look for better rates in the city 1.2 Exchange at the Domestic Terminal Location: Eximbank exchange counter near souvenir shops on the 2nd floor Notes and advice Don’t forget your passport The airport provides transparent and safe exchange services For better rates, consider exchanging in the city Exchanging currency at Da Nang Airport is recommended as a first step of your Vietnam trip. USD, EUR, JPY and other major currencies are supported, with several reliable banks and exchange counters available. Fees and rates vary by counter, so check in advance. There are many exchange places in the city as well, but changing some money at the airport makes your trip smoother. Da Nang Airport Address Đ. Exchange at Vincom Plaza On the 1st floor of Vincom Plaza in central Da Nang, the VietinBank exchange counter is a trusted spot where you can exchange currency safely and quickly. Convenient location: On the left of the Ngo Quyen Street entrance, just 2 km from Pham Van Dong Beach, with excellent access. Supported currencies: All currencies supported. An LED screen shows the latest rates. Comfortable amenities: Seating available while you wait. Located inside Vincom Plaza where you can also shop and dine. This is the ideal spot to exchange currency in the heart of Da Nang while enjoying shopping! Exchange in Son Tra District DUY TUNG gold shop is reputed by locals as offering “the best rate in Da Nang.” It supports all currencies including JPY, KRW, USD, as well as MYR, IDR, CNY—convenient for travelers. Why “DUY TUNG” is recommended: High rates, peace of mind: A gold shop frequently used by locals, known for good rates. Trustworthy and friendly: Run by a local couple with kind, attentive service. Good access: Located inside Ha Than Market in Son Tra District, easy access from the Han River. How to get there: From Tran Hung Dao Street along the Han River, head toward “Happy Yacht.” Go straight along Trieu Viet Vuong Street opposite Happy Yacht. Three gold shops line the left-hand side; DUY TUNG is the middle one. Local acquaintances also recommend it, saying they frequently exchange USD here. A hidden exchange spot The An Thuong area is popular with tourists, but exchange counters are actually limited and can be hard to find—especially when you suddenly need cash to pay for a taxi, for example. In that case, we recommend the exchange counter in the lobby of the “Van apartment” rental building. We found this hidden spot after a full day of searching. It’s such a hidden place that even locals may not know it’s there—you could easily walk past without realizing it offers exchange service. According to the owner, all currencies are supported. Hidden yet handy: Located in an apartment lobby, used by both tourists and locals. Reliable rates: Since it handles many currencies, the rates are said to be relatively good. If you’re struggling to find an exchange in An Thuong, the lobby counter at “Van apartment” is a safe, hidden option. Exchange open late at Son Tra Night Market It’s not widely known, but Son Tra Night Market has a convenient exchange counter open until late. Operated by the Son Tra Night Market Management Board, it’s open from 17:30 to 00:00 to match the market’s hours. This is helpful when it’s outside normal business hours, banks are closed, or there’s no exchange counter nearby. From the market entrance, go along the right-hand aisle to the 5th shop. Look for the “Money Exchange” sign. All currencies are supported, including JPY, USD, and CNY. It’s also perfect if you don’t want to leave Vietnam with leftover dong. Located at the foot of Dragon Bridge, you can enjoy local food and souvenir shopping as well as exchange. High-rate exchange near Han Market: “Soan Ha” gold shop “Soan Ha” gold shop, located just by Han Market, is a popular exchange spot for tourists. Many Korean travelers use it, and even high denominations like 50,000 won are handled smoothly. If you’re wondering “how much can I exchange in Da Nang,” you can check good rates here with confidence. Best USD rates on Tran Phu Street This shop offers the best USD rates on Tran Phu Street. The owner serves you quickly, and you can check the rate directly on the calculator, so you can exchange with peace of mind. Prime location for tourists Located in the Han Market area where many tourists gather, it’s easy to stop by while sightseeing. There are many gold shops nearby, so you can compare rates. Note the closing time They close at 19:00, a bit early, so visit with time to spare. If you can’t make it, there is another gold shop across the street you can consider.
